Window well improvement services involve upgrading or repairing the structures that surround basement windows to ensure they function properly and provide adequate protection. These services typically include installing new window wells, replacing damaged or rusted covers, and adding features like drainage systems or reinforcement to prevent structural issues. Properly maintained window wells help keep dirt, debris, and water out of basement areas, reducing the risk of flooding, mold, and water damage. Homeowners may seek these services to enhance the safety, appearance, and functionality of their basement windows.
Many common problems can be addressed through window well improvements. For example, old or rusted window wells can become hazardous or ineffective at keeping water away from the foundation. Water pooling around basement windows can lead to leaks and interior flooding, especially during heavy rains or storms. Additionally, poorly designed or damaged window wells may pose safety concerns, such as tripping hazards or difficulty opening windows in emergencies. Upgrading or repairing window wells can help prevent these issues, making basements safer and more secure.

The overview below groups typical Window Well Improvement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in North Charleston, SC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ine window well repairs in North Charleston range from $250 to $600. Most projects involve fixing leaks, rust, or minor structural issues and fall within this middle range. Fewer jobs require extensive work that exceeds this budget.
Partial Replacement - Replacing a window well or upgrading its components usually costs between $600 and $1,500. Many local contractors handle these projects efficiently within this band, though larger or more complex replacements can reach up to $3,000.
Full Well Replacement - Complete replacement of a window well, including excavation and new materials, generally costs $1,500 to $4,000. These larger projects are less common but are necessary for significant structural or safety improvements.
Custom or Large-Scale Projects - Custom-designed or extensive well improvements, such as installing multiple wells or advanced drainage systems, can range from $4,000 to over $8,000. Such projects are less frequent and typically involve specialized service providers for complex need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
